Cambridge Introductions to Literature synopsis
What is narrative? How do you work and how do we shape our lives and the texts we read? H. Porter Abbott asserts that narration is found not only in literature, cinema and theater, but everywhere in the ordinary course of people's lives.
This widely used information, which has now been fully revised, is being updated throughout the latest developments in this area and includes two new chapters. With a clear introduction to concepts and proposals for further reading, this book is not only an excellent introduction to courses that focus on narration but also an invaluable resource for students and researchers across a wide range of fields, including literature, drama, cinema, media, society, politics, journalism, biography, history and still Others in all arts, humanities and social sciences..
